An introduction to linux user account monitoring enable sysadmin. The activity displayed by lastactivityview includes. Finding out the groups to which a user account belongs helps give you a better understanding of that users access and troubleshoot when things dont work right. Sysdig is an opensource, crossplatform, powerful and flexible system monitoring and troubleshooting tool for linux.
This program provides an excellent way to monitor what users are doing. How to see which groups your linux user account belongs to. Linux top command is a performance monitoring program which is used frequently by many system administrators to monitor linux performance and it is available under many linux unix like operating systems. The auditing is not enabled by default because any monitoring you use consumes some part of system resources, so tracking down too much events may cause a considerable system slowdown. Check for your brand, trademark, product or user name on 160 social networks.
Adblock detected my website is made possible by displaying online advertisements to my visitors. Some of them come preinstalled within common distributions, some can be downloaded as freeware, and some are commercially available products. It doesnt necessarily show every process, because not all programs initiate utmp logging. I stopped paying for this software and no longer use it because i have no use for it.
They might not even have created an entry in etcpasswd, but to some other database instead. Were given virtualbox vdi images and raw files for the state of a linux server at 3 different dates. System tray share monitor, while not that small in size, portable, or standalone, is an open source software which pretty much does the same thing as net share monitor. Monitoring linux user activities and auditing them unix. These tools are available in all major linux distros. Monitor user activity on windows server network enterprise. During his career, he has worked as a freelance programmer, manager of an international software development team, an it services project manager, and, most recently, as a data protection officer. If your organizations policies prevents you from viewing reports where user information is identifiable, you can change the privacy setting for all these reports. However, since the audit rules will be checked for each syscall on the server, it can mean a decreased performance. The lastlog command reports the most recent login of all users.
Click the first row in the list that corresponds to a client. In this video discussion is on user activity monitoring,process accounting on rhelcentos 7 this is handy when system admin troubleshoots performancesecu. Even more, since not all user activity is of interest for logging, auditing policies enable us capturing only event types that we consider being important. Retrieving user activity on server windows server spiceworks. Here is a quick overview of 5 commandline tools that come in incredibly handy when troubleshooting or monitoring realtime disk activity in linux. The whowatch program scans the most current common log file of linux server and creates the following statistics in real time. Router settings vary depending on your routers brand. Jan 10, 2018 groups help define the permissions and access your linux user account has to files, folders, settings, and more. I have not installed any security or auditing software. Its called audit, and it can log a very great deal of information, for one or more specific users or for all users. You can analyze and investigate the users activities, and try to find the root cause of the problem. I know that last command can be used to find out who was logged in and for how long. How to monitor linux commands executed by system users in real.
A variety of methods exist for auditing user activity in unix and linux environments. The file etcnf will show how your log files are configured. Lastactivityview view the latest computer activity in. It allows us to obtain a realtime control of the traffic sent and received in a period of time, chosen by the user. How to delete a user on linux and remove every trace. One can use the compgen command to list all users and other resources too. The id command displays the users uid and all the users groups and gids. To get a glimpse of what users are doing on the system, you can use the w command as. Apr 27, 2014 linux top command is a performance monitoring program which is used frequently by many system administrators to monitor linux performance and it is available under many linux unix like operating systems. File monitor software for server and activity monitoring. Using windows auditing to track user activity peter gubarevich.
How can i find out under which user i am currently logged in on my linux system. If youre looking for anything involving the user authorization mechanism, you can find it in this log file. Monitoring user activity in unixlinux environments observeit monitors all user activity on unix and linux servers and desktops. The result is a complete solution for identifying and managing userbased risk. Click remote client status to navigate to the remote client activity and status user interface in the remote access management console. Username search for the most popular social media and social networking sites from.
File monitoring software can also send alerts on file changes that can be set up to notify on specific file conditions, so you only receive critical alerts for issues you care more about. We do have a firewall and reporting available on it, but it is more for tracking user activity online. Displaying daywise login statistics of a particular user. While windows is built for the average homeofficer, gamer, or grandparent and comes with its own set of controls to stop these users destroying their operating systems linux enjoys a total lack of restrictions but also exposes the user to an. How to monitor user activity with psacct or acct tools. Linux forensics questions ssh config, user activity. If the user has a home directory, you can check that directories creation. The best employee monitoring software for 2020 pcmag.
The way how to know version of an installed package varies for different programs. This is also where all browsing activity is stored. If the hackers have tried to hide their tracks, they might not have created an entry in etcshadow. It will be helpful when something went wrong in the server. Using user activity monitoring to detect threats faster. Ads are annoying but they help keep this website running. Activtrak is a workforce productivity and analytics application that helps organizations understand how and what people do at work. The system generates video recordings, user activity logs and realtime alerts. The last command will show user logins, logouts, system reboots and run level changes. Sysdig a powerful system monitoring and troubleshooting.
Now with these applications one will be able to track not only user activity, but that of all administrators as well that is performed on a particular server. May 16, 2011 system tray share monitor, while not that small in size, portable, or standalone, is an open source software which pretty much does the same thing as net share monitor. How to check who is the active user or non active user whose id exists but the access p the unix and linux forums. As a linux administrator, you need to keep track of all users activities. Linux administrators security guide linux system and user. I want to find out everything possible about how the pc was used in the past few days. It is hard to keep the site running and producing new content when so many people continue reading monitor linux user activity in real time. This feature lists down all the ip addresses that are connected to your router. One feature of linux and most unices is the syslog and klog facilities which allow software to generate log messages that are then passed to alog daemon and handled written to a local file, a remote server, given to aprogram, and so on. It was the boss that wanted to spy on everyone and for me it was just another. Suppose your server is behaving unusually and you suspect a recently installed software package to be the root cause for this issue. How to monitor user activity, performing process accounting. How can i log the activity of users for the last 24 hours by terminal in a system. In such cases, you can check this log file to find out the packages that were installed recently and identify the malfunctioning program.
Our cloudbased user activity monitoring software provides contextual data and insights that enable midmarket organizations to be. Sep 16, 2016 in this video discussion is on user activity monitoring,process accounting on rhelcentos 7 this is handy when system admin troubleshoots performancesecu. In this brief linux system security guide, we will explain how to view all linux shell commands executed by system users in realtime. Track the installation of system components and software packages. The accounting utilities provides the useful information about system usage, such as connections, programs executed, and utilization of system. Yes, sure its polling, but i doubt anyone requires performance here.
Check the messages logged here to see whether a package was. User activity monitoring software can deliver videolike playback of user activity and process the videos into user activity logs that keep stepbystep records of user actions that can be searched and analyzed to investigate any outofscope activities. They run in the background keeping track of user activity on a system and the resources consumed by services such as mysql, apache, ftp, ssh, et al. Mar 11, 2020 after over 30 years in the it industry, he is now a fulltime technology journalist. What audit log files are created in linux to track a users activities. Use activity reports for microsoft teams microsoft teams. Best network monitoring tools for linux linuxandubuntu.
The w command prints a summary of the current activity on the system, including what each user is doing. Are you a linux system administrator and want to monitor interactive activity of all system users linux commands they executes in realtime. Helps you troubleshoot issues related to software installations. Im a linux noob and have an assignment im a bit stumped on.
Dave is a linux evangelist and open source advocate. There are some things you can do to get the creation date but all of them depend on a specific set of circumstances andor software to determine that date and time. Ever since the first timesharing systems appeared in the early 1960s and brought with them the capability for multiple users to work on a single computer, theres been a need to isolate and compartmentalize the files and data of each user from all the other users. And because this application has more than one user its difficult to track who did what and when, because everybody. Monitoring users internet activity webcontentfiltering.
How to install linux, nginx, mysql, php lemp stack on ubuntu 20. After over 30 years in the it industry, he is now a fulltime technology journalist. Ive been tasked to check whether the user of a script has administrative privileges as they are needed to run certain parts of the script, and if not notify the user to run the script with admin pr. Below the first line is an entry for each user that displays the login name, the tty name, the remote host, login time, idle time, jcpu, pcpu, and the command line of the user. When i connected to the server using ssh and ran who it showed that a user is logged in from an ip that i didnt recognize.
Monitor user activity in realtime using sysdig in linux. How to checkfind who all are the users accessing the server using their id. This would have required them to add an entry to the passwd line in etcnf entries in etcpasswd and etcshadow appear in the order they. I need to know what i can extract out of a default. User activity monitoring uam software tracks the behavior of users in your it environment, looking for suspicious activity. User activity monitoring is vital in helping mitigate increasing insider threats, implement cert best practices and get compliant however, it is important to stress that without enhanced user access controls and restrictions or the ability to filter and alert on specific.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Click or tap columns to add or remove columns in the. Commands to help you monitor activity on your linux server. How to find out user info with id, groups and finger. By helping you promptly spot malicious insiders, compromised accounts, malware infections and other problem, user activity monitoring helps you reduce the risk of downtime, data breaches and compliance penalties.
The top command used to dipslay all the running and active realtime processes in ordered list and updates it regularly. You will see the list of users who are connected to the remote access server and detailed statistics about them. One of the most critical tasks you have as a system administrator is to monitor your system for any suspicious activity that might indicate a. How to monitor linux commands executed by system users in. The best practice is to include the c or comment option when creating a user. In this video discussion is on user activity monitoring,process accounting on rhelcentos 7 this is handy when system admin troubleshoots performancesecurity issues. How to check find who all are the users accessing the server using their id. This program may be capable of spawning further processes, and thus, i. Lastactivityview is a tool for windows operating system that collects information from various sources on a running system, and displays a log of actions made by the user and events occurred on this computer.
To get a list of all linux users you type the following getent command. Before you check the logs, you should know the target devices ip address. How to monitor user activity on linux with psacct or acct. Both linux and unix freebsdsolaris has w command to show who is logged on and what they are doing.
This is an acronym that describes a linux operating system, with an nginx pronounced like enginex web server. How can i check installed program versions in terminal. Using windows auditing to track user activity peter. Ive been tasked to check whether the user of a script has administrative privileges as they are needed to run certain parts of the script, and if not notify the user to run the script with admin pr the unix and linux forums. A file monitor is designed to create a baseline for comparing file characteristics against future changes. How to view system users in linux on ubuntu digitalocean. Linux or unixlike software runs the majority of the worlds servers.
This is owing to its incredible power, transparency, and customizability. Sep 15, 2017 are you a linux system administrator and want to monitor interactive activity of all system users linux commands they executes in realtime. The watch command is one that makes it easy to repeatedly examine a variety of data on your system user activities, running processes, logins, memory usage. Our cloudbased user activity monitoring software provides contextual data and insights that enable midmarket organizations to be more productive, secure, and compliant. You should evaluate login activity for signs of a security breach, such as multiple failed logins. Planning to catch pranksters sneaking up on my computer with it and a little scripting.
Sep 05, 20 how to install linux, nginx, mysql, php lemp stack on ubuntu 20. Monitor user activity across a windows serverbased network is key to knowing what is going on in your windows environment. Is there any command for that, for example ver or something similar. Say, i have a program, and i want to monitor its filesystem activity what filesdirectories are createdmodifieddeleted etc. Red hat enterprise linux 6 provides you with the lslogins commandline utility, which gives you a comprehensive overview of users and groups, not only regarding user or group account configuration but also their activity on the system. The lemp software stack is a group of software that can be used to serve dynamic web pages and web applications written in php. Monitor connected remote clients for activity and status. There were tools for admins to communicate with users, and to monitor their activity to. He wants to see which folders were accessed and at what times but we told him that this is not possible. Monitoring users activity using psacct or acct tools in linux.
97 666 1357 1139 702 1265 1414 995 1410 78 1523 1261 1248 825 816 10 54 1381 138 1607 1257 136 166 98 673 1013 246 261 165 28 769 1125 657 177 1299 876 1164 1262 287 490 885 1041 193 409 1163 1312 319